The phrase "affected uniformly"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used to describe a situation where something has an equal impact or influence across all relevant areas or subjects.
Example: "The new policy was designed to ensure that all employees were affected uniformly, regardless of their department."
Alternatives: "impacted equally" or "influenced consistently".
